Exceptional pair of Danish Modern reclining lounge chairs with matching ottomans by J.M. Birking & Co. A/S of Copenhagen, Denmark, circa 1970.
Crafted from richly grained rosewood, each chair features a sculptural exposed frame, slatted back, padded leather armrests, and deeply tufted brown leather cushions. The original leather has developed a beautiful, warm patina over decades of use, with natural tonal variation, creasing, and character that complement the dark rosewood frames beautifully.
Both chairs feature an adjustable reclining mechanism operated by a discreet side control, allowing the backrest to recline smoothly for an exceptionally comfortable seating position. The exposed rear construction showcases the chair’s distinctive suspension system and Scandinavian craftsmanship.
The matching rosewood ottomans feature coordinating button-tufted leather cushions and complete the set.
The chairs retain their J.M. Birking & Co. A/S, Copenhagen, Denmark maker markings.
